If you missed the television show “An Overview of Starting a Colt” that aired on RFD-TV in July, the hour-long program will be airing on the station again this week. During the episode, Clinton explains his approach to colt starting by working with a wild mustang named Ransom. You’ll witness Ransom go from untouched to riding confidently outside the arena on a loose rein.

The show will also give you an inside look at Clinton’s acclaimed Colt Starting Series, a training kit that comes with 11 DVDs and 26 Arena Mates.
